Aizawl, Aug. 22 -- Security agencies in Mizoram today seized nearly 5 lakh methamphetamine tablets in a major joint operation on the Aizawl-Champhai highway, arresting eight people and dismantling a key trafficking attempt along the sensitive Myanmar corridor.
Acting on intelligence, the Border Security Force (BSF),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) Aizawl, and the state Excise & Narcotics Department intercepted four vehicles near Keifang-Seling, about 60 km from Aizawl. The search yielded 50 kg of suspected methamphetamine tablets, packed in 50 packets, and 36 grams of heroin. The vehicles used in transportation were also seized.
